MEMO — Kettling Depot Receiving

Uniform sets for the new Kettling depot arrive Wednesday via Ashgrove courier: 40 boxes, sorted by size, manifest attached to box one. Check the count at the dock before signing; shortages go straight to stores, not the courier. The hand-over instruction the courier will follow is set out below.

drop instructions, tafof-baguf: the holmir gilox courier leaves the sormir ulaok holdor ledger at gate 5596 under passcode 257343

**Catalog cache flush — Plumeria**

New folks: when product edits don't show up on the storefront, it's almost always a stale catalog cache. Run the invalidation job against the Plumeria edge tier, wait two minutes, then spot-check a few SKUs. Don't nuke the whole cache during peak hours. Grab the token from the job output below.

build token for fahap-yagag: htk3_d09

Ticket: Deep-link config drift between Wrenfield staging and prod

Hey — heads up before Thursday's release. The deep-link routing table for the Wrenfield app has drifted again: staging routes /offers to the new promo screen, but prod still points at the legacy webview. Looks like someone patched prod directly after the Maplecart campaign and the change never made it back into the repo. Can we freeze edits until this ships? Prod is currently running with the following values.

settings of fawip-yadug:
[druath]
port = 3000
region = north-4
host = druath.qirvanworks.corp
timeout_ms = 1500
retries = 1